For Sale: Turn-Key 2006 Bailey Upright Lightning Sprint with ’05-’06 Suzuki GSXR-1000 (gas). Power Commander V with AutoTune, Viper exhaust pipe, K&N washable air filter, oil cooler, EVANS waterless engine coolant. Has Infinity compression adjustable right rear shock, Infinity rebound adjustable left rear shock, cockpit adjuster knobs and cables (if your rules allow), QA1 threaded aluminum small bodies on the front, Bailey front axle, 2" 31 spline rear axle, oil pressure and water temperature gauges. Right Rear tire is a Hoosier SP-2 with 8 laps on it. Seat included (belts go out of date in May 15). Spares include 1 RR beadlock wheel, 1 LR beadlock wheel, 1 front non-beadlock wheel, wheel wrench, front axle, radius rods, torsion stops, 2 QA1 shocks, 5 torsion bars, Rear sprockets 44T through 53T (a couple new), Front 14T, 15T, 17T sprockets, oil pan, new Suzuki oil filter, a few used tires, and a few odds and ends. Oil was changed every other race, and filter was changed every other oil change. We had the motor compression tested and inspected prior to 2014 season (ran 4 races in 14), and was told compression was excellent and everything inside was in good shape and very clean. Sprayed all heims with WD-40 before and after every race. Soaked the chain in motor oil every 5 races. Tail tank cover color does not match the rest of the car, and it DOES NOT INCLUDE top wing because I’m keeping them as souvenirs on the shop wall. I’ve raced 7 cars in 11 years, and this is by far my favorite and the best I’ve driven. I don’t want to sell it, but we’re moving to asphalt Late Model Sportsman, and I have to in order to make that happen. I am the 2nd owner. The original owner won some features in Connecticut. I ran 23 races from 2012 through 2014 and had 13 finishes of 1st or 2nd, with 4 feature wins, 4 heat wins, and a track championship. Most of those were in local races, but we ran about 5 MMSA races. I felt we had a top 5 car in those races, but I usually made a mistake in qualifying and started deep in the field, or we had some other hiccup. When we bought the car, the guy was asking $12,000 and I traded a full size Sprint Car roller for it. Since then I have added the Power Commander, Adjustable rear shocks, Viper Pipe, and a few other modifications. Halfway through 2013, I had a run in with a concrete wall and bent the right front torsion tube and right front corner of the frame a little bit. We were running for points and didn’t have time or money to have it fixed at that time, so we ran the next race with coil overs on the front. Turns out, I liked that better, so we never got that corner fixed. As far as performance, we ran 10 races after that wreck and had 2 feature wins, and 5 runner-ups.
